Foundation Steel Industry: Current Status & Development Trends

The global infrastructure reinforcement market is undergoing a fundamental transformation. Traditional steel rebar, long the default choice for road and bridge foundations, is being challenged by next-generation composite materials — with basalt fiber leading the charge.

🌎

Global Market Expansion

The global fiber reinforced polymer (FRP) rebar market is projected to exceed USD 1.8 billion by 2030, driven by surging demand for corrosion-resistant foundation steel in coastal highways, marine bridges, and high-humidity environments across Asia-Pacific, North America, and Europe.

Sustainability Mandates

Government infrastructure policies in the EU, USA, and China now mandate the use of sustainable, low-carbon construction materials. Basalt fiber rebar — produced from 100% natural volcanic rock with zero chemical additives — aligns perfectly with green building standards and carbon neutrality targets for road and bridge projects.

📈

Rising Steel Replacement Rate

Engineering firms globally are reporting 15–30% cost savings over 50-year lifecycle analyses when replacing conventional steel with basalt fiber rebar in bridge decks and road subbase layers, factoring in zero maintenance for corrosion, reduced repair cycles, and lighter structural loads.

🔧

Smart Infrastructure Integration

The integration of basalt fiber composites with IoT-enabled structural health monitoring systems is a rapidly emerging trend. Non-conductive basalt rebar allows sensors to be embedded directly in bridge piers and road foundations without electromagnetic interference — enabling real-time structural data collection.

🏭

Industrial Standardization

Major standardization bodies including ASTM International, ISO, and China's GB standards are actively incorporating basalt fiber rebar specifications into official construction codes, accelerating adoption in public infrastructure tenders and enabling engineers to specify basalt as a primary foundation material.

💡

R&D Breakthroughs

Recent milestones — including basalt fiber applications in China's Chang'e-6 lunar mission and the world's first deep-sea basalt fiber aquaculture platform — have dramatically elevated the profile of basalt fiber technology, attracting increased investment into road and bridge-specific composite development programs worldwide.

🏛

Unveiling the Infinite Potential of Basalt — From highway subbase reinforcement to suspension bridge cable wrapping, basalt fiber composites are redefining what foundation steel can achieve in 21st-century infrastructure.

🛣

Highway & Expressway Foundations

Basalt fiber geogrid and rebar are deployed in the subbase and base layers of high-traffic expressways to prevent reflective cracking, distribute load more evenly, and resist the cyclical fatigue stresses that cause premature road failure. Field data from projects in China and Russia show a 40–60% increase in pavement service life when basalt fiber reinforcement is used in the foundation layer.

🌞

Bridge Deck & Pier Reinforcement

Chloride-induced corrosion of steel rebar is the leading cause of bridge deck deterioration globally, costing billions annually. Basalt fiber rebar is completely immune to chloride attack, making it the ideal foundation steel for bridge decks, pier caps, and abutments in coastal, marine, and de-iced road environments. Bridge pier protection wrapping with basalt fiber composites also provides outstanding resistance to vehicle collision and fire damage.

Tunnel Portal & Retaining Wall Structures

In tunnel approach sections and retaining walls adjacent to roads and bridges, basalt fiber mesh and chopped strand reinforced shotcrete deliver superior crack resistance and long-term structural integrity. The material's resistance to freeze-thaw cycles and chemical attack from road de-icing salts makes it especially valuable in mountainous highway infrastructure.

💧

Drainage & Culvert Systems

Underground drainage pipes and culverts beneath road and bridge foundations are chronically vulnerable to soil chemical attack and groundwater corrosion. Basalt fiber reinforced concrete pipes and culverts offer a service life of 50–100 years with zero maintenance, compared to 15–25 years for conventional steel-reinforced alternatives.

🌍

Seismic Retrofitting of Existing Bridges

Basalt fiber reinforced polymer (BFRP) wrapping systems are increasingly used to seismically retrofit existing bridge columns and piers. The high tensile strength and ductility of basalt fiber composites provide confinement to concrete columns, dramatically improving their ability to withstand lateral seismic forces — a critical application as aging road and bridge infrastructure faces increasing seismic risk assessment requirements.

🔌

Smart Road Sensor Embedding

The non-electromagnetic nature of basalt fiber rebar enables the seamless embedding of fiber optic sensors and strain gauges within road and bridge foundations. This creates smart infrastructure capable of monitoring structural health, traffic load, temperature gradients, and early-stage cracking — providing engineers with real-time data to optimize maintenance schedules and prevent catastrophic failures.

Basalt Fiber Roving for Road & Bridge Composite Manufacturing

cp28bw cp2p38 cp2jes cp2wrb

Basalt Fiber Roving

Basalt Fiber Roving is the foundational raw material for manufacturing a wide range of composite products used in road and bridge infrastructure. Produced by drawing continuous filaments from molten basalt rock at 1,450–1,500°C, our roving delivers exceptional mechanical properties with a minimal environmental footprint.

Used extensively in pultrusion, filament winding, and weaving processes, basalt fiber roving enables the production of structural profiles, bridge deck panels, drainage pipes, and geogrid fabrics that serve as next-generation foundation steel alternatives in modern infrastructure construction.
